Historical Events

2019
Moderate

A heatwave event caused increased demand on local resources and infrastructure.

2016
Moderate

Significant flooding along the Murray River impacted low-lying areas in the region.

2009
Major

Prolonged heatwave conditions led to heat stress and health concerns.

What due diligence is needed before buying in Murray Downs?

Due diligence for Murray Downs property purchases should include: climate risk report for the specific address, flood and bushfire overlay review from your local council, pre-purchase insurance quotes, understanding disclosure obligations under New South Wales law, and considering long-term climate projections to 2050.

How will climate change affect property values in Murray Downs?

Climate change may affect Murray Downs property values through insurance affordability, buyer risk perception, lender conditions in high-risk areas, and physical damage from extreme weather. Properties with lower hazard exposure may command premiums over higher-risk properties in the same suburb.
